France has one of Europe's largest and most diversified dairy industries, supported by a strong base of milk, cheese, butter, cream and fermented-dairy production. This provides a broad domestic supply of dairy ingredients for blended formulations.
• The French dairy industry has a strong value-added processing structure, with cheese, fresh dairy products, butter and cream playing important roles alongside conventional drinking milk. This creates opportunities for dairy blends used in both dairy and non-dairy food manufacturing.
• Cheese Blends have a particularly strong position in France because of the country's extensive cheese-processing industry and wide variety of cheese types. Different cheese ingredients can be combined to deliver specific flavor, melting, texture and processing characteristics.
• Milk Blends and Cream Blends are widely relevant to French food manufacturing, particularly in bakery, confectionery, desserts, sauces, prepared foods and beverages where dairy solids, fat and creaminess are required.
• France has a strong yogurt and fermented-dairy sector, supporting demand for yogurt-based and cultured dairy blends used in chilled products, beverages and desserts.
• The country's advanced food-processing industry creates demand for dairy ingredients beyond traditional dairy products. Dairy blends are incorporated into bakery & confectionery, dairy & frozen desserts, beverages, infant formula & nutrition, processed foods and foodservice.
• France is also an important European dairy exporter, allowing domestic dairy processors and ingredient manufacturers to operate at significant scale and serve both French and international food manufacturers.
• Demand is increasingly influenced by ingredient functionality, nutritional value, product reformulation, premium dairy products, sustainability and cost efficiency.

Market Dynamics



Driver: Strong domestic dairy-processing base
France has a well-established dairy industry covering milk, cheese, butter, cream, yogurt and other fermented products. The breadth of this processing base provides manufacturers with access to a wide range of dairy components that can be combined into application-specific blends..

Challenge: Raw-material cost fluctuations
Milk, butterfat, cheese, milk powder and protein prices can fluctuate, affecting the cost of dairy-blend formulations. Manufacturers therefore increasingly focus on formulation optimization and flexible sourcing.

Trend: Dairy proteins and nutritional functionality
Milk and whey proteins are increasingly relevant to nutritional and functional food formulations. Dairy blends can combine protein ingredients with milk solids and dairy fats to achieve both nutritional and technical functionality.

Policies & Regulatory Landscape


• Dairy product identity and composition are important for milk, cream, butter, cheese, yogurt and other dairy products. EU rules reserve specific dairy names for products meeting the applicable requirements, which is particularly relevant when developing or marketing blended dairy formulations.
• Milk allergen declaration is particularly important for dairy blends. Milk and products derived from milk are among the allergens that must be declared when present in the finished food, with allergen information appropriately emphasized in the ingredient declaration.
• Origin and traceability requirements are relevant to French dairy products. France has specific requirements concerning the indication of milk origin in certain dairy products, supporting greater transparency regarding where milk is collected, processed and packaged.
• Quality and origin certifications are particularly relevant in France. Dairy products can participate in European and French quality schemes such as AOP, IGP, Label Rouge and organic certification. These schemes impose specific production or sourcing requirements and are especially relevant to traditional and regionally identified French dairy products.
• Import requirements affect dairy-blend sourcing. Dairy ingredients entering France from outside the EU must comply with applicable EU sanitary and border-control requirements. The EU has also updated requirements concerning the entry of certain dairy products from third countries, making import compliance an important consideration for international dairy-ingredient suppliers.

Production, Sourcing & Supply Chain Analysis


• Domestic milk sourcing is the foundation of the French dairy-blend supply chain. Milk is collected through established dairy networks and directed toward specialized processing facilities. The main milk-producing areas are concentrated in the northwestern regions, particularly Brittany, Normandy and Pays de la Loire, creating strong regional clusters of dairy production and processing.
• European sourcing complements domestic production. French dairy manufacturers can source specialized ingredients from other EU countries when particular cheese types, dairy proteins, powders, fats or other specifications are required. The integrated EU dairy market allows manufacturers to maintain flexible sourcing while accessing a wider regional supplier base.
• Export-oriented processing is also important to France's dairy supply chain. French dairy processors serve domestic food manufacturers as well as international customers, particularly across European markets. This supports large-scale processing and creates established channels for dairy ingredients and formulated dairy products.
• Cold-chain distribution remains essential for liquid and semi-solid dairy ingredients such as cream, yogurt, fresh cheese and other chilled formulations. Powdered dairy ingredients provide greater storage and transportation flexibility and are therefore better suited to long-distance industrial supply.

Segment Analysis



France Dairy Blends Market By Product Type
• Milk blends have a broad role in France because of the country's large milk-processing and food-manufacturing base. They are used to adjust milk solids, protein, fat and flavor in beverages, bakery products, processed foods, dairy products and nutritional formulations. France's substantial production of milk and dairy products provides a strong domestic ingredient base.
• Cream blends are well suited to the French market because cream is widely used across desserts, bakery, confectionery, sauces and prepared foods. Blending cream with other dairy components allows manufacturers to achieve specific richness, viscosity, fat content and mouthfeel while maintaining consistent processing performance. French cream production and consumption provide a strong downstream base for this segment.
• Butter blends are used where manufacturers require controlled dairy-fat performance, butter flavor and texture. They have applications in French bakery, pastry, confectionery, sauces, prepared foods and foodservice. France's established butter industry provides a strong supply of dairy-fat ingredients for these formulations, while its high butter consumption supports continued industrial use.
• Cheese blends are a particularly important segment in France because of the country's large and highly diversified cheese industry. Manufacturers can combine different cheese varieties to achieve specific flavor, melting, stretching and texture characteristics. This is relevant to prepared meals, sauces, bakery, snacks, pizza and foodservice. France's extensive range of cheeses and strong cheese production make it one of the most distinctive product categories in the country's dairy-blend market.
• Yogurt blends are supported by France's established fermented-dairy market. They are used to create yogurt, cultured beverages, chilled desserts and other formulations requiring controlled acidity, viscosity, creaminess and flavor. Recent French dairy production trends have shown continued strength in yogurts and fermented milks, supporting this segment.
• Other dairy blends include combinations of milk proteins, whey ingredients, milk solids, dairy fats and cultured components developed for specific industrial requirements. In France, these formulations are relevant to functional foods, nutrition, specialty beverages and food-processing applications where manufacturers need a combination of nutritional and technical properties.

France Dairy Blends Market By Nature
• Bakery & Confectionery is a strong application for dairy blends in France because dairy ingredients are deeply integrated into the country's bread, pastry, viennoiserie, biscuits, chocolate and confectionery industries. Milk powders, butter blends, cream ingredients and dairy proteins contribute to flavor, richness, browning, softness and texture.
• Dairy & Frozen Desserts represents an important application because France has a mature market for yogurts, fermented dairy products, fresh dairy desserts and ice cream. Dairy blends help manufacturers control milk solids, fat, protein, viscosity and creaminess. The strength of French yogurt and fresh-dairy production provides a substantial base for this application.
• Beverages use dairy blends mainly in milk-based drinks, fermented dairy beverages, nutritional beverages and protein-oriented formulations. Milk powders, dairy proteins and cream components can be combined to provide controlled protein, milk solids, mouthfeel and flavor. The opportunity is stronger in value-added and functional beverages than in conventional liquid milk.
• Infant Formula & Nutrition is a specialized application where dairy blends are used to provide controlled combinations of milk proteins, whey proteins, lactose, milk solids and dairy fats. France's established dairy-ingredient and food-processing capabilities support this segment, while the highly regulated nature of nutritional products requires consistent ingredient specifications, quality control and traceability.
• Processed Foods provides a broad industrial outlet for dairy blends in France. Cheese, cream, butter, milk powders and dairy proteins are incorporated into ready meals, sauces, soups, snacks, fillings and convenience foods. Cheese blends are especially useful for controlled flavor and melting performance, while milk and cream blends provide richness, body and texture.
• Foodservice demand is supported by France's large restaurant, bakery, catering and commercial-food sector. Dairy blends are used where operators require consistent flavor, texture, melting and cooking performance. Cheese blends are relevant to prepared dishes, sauces and baked foods, while butter and cream blends are used extensively in cooking, pastry and desserts.
• Other Applications include sports nutrition, functional foods, specialized nutrition, food ingredients and customized industrial formulations. These applications use dairy proteins, whey components, milk solids and dairy fats where a specific nutritional or technical function is required rather than simply providing conventional dairy flavor.

France Dairy Blends Market By Form
• Powder is an important form for industrial dairy blends because it provides longer storage, easier transportation and precise dosing. Milk powders, whey powders and other dry dairy ingredients can be incorporated into bakery, beverages, nutrition, processed foods and dry formulations. France's established milk-powder and industrial dairy sector supports this format.
• Liquid dairy blends are used where manufacturers require direct incorporation into liquid processing systems. They are relevant to dairy beverages, sauces, desserts and other formulations where fresh dairy characteristics are important. The main supply-chain consideration is refrigerated storage and transportation.
• Semi-Solid dairy blends are used where manufacturers require creaminess, spreadability, concentrated dairy fat or a defined texture. They are relevant to butter-based preparations, cream formulations, cheese products, fillings, sauces, desserts and foodservice applications.
